What is LMS Compliance's market cap?
LMS Compliance (LMS) has a market capitalization of approximately S$58M, trading at S$0.42 on the SES. Market cap moves with the live share price.
What is LMS Compliance's P/E ratio?
LMS Compliance's trailing twelve-month P/E ratio is 28.3x, with a price-to-book (P/B) of 3.7x. Valuation multiples are best compared with Industrials sector peers rather than read in isolation.
How profitable is LMS Compliance?
LMS Compliance runs a net profit margin of 19.3%, a gross margin of 43.1%, and an operating margin of 29.1%. Margins and ROE indicate how efficiently the business converts sales into profit and shareholder returns.
How much revenue does LMS Compliance generate?
LMS Compliance reported revenue of RM32M for fiscal year 2025, with net income of RM6M and earnings per share (EPS) of 0.047. SniperIQ tracks the full 8-quarter revenue and margin trend on the research dashboard.
Does LMS Compliance pay a dividend?
LMS Compliance offers a trailing dividend yield of about 2.4%. Dividend sustainability depends on payout ratio, free cash flow, and earnings stability — all tracked in SniperIQ's fundamentals view.
Is LMS Compliance financially healthy?
LMS Compliance carries a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.05x and a current ratio of 4.05x, with a market beta of -0.01. Lower leverage and a current ratio above 1.0 generally signal a stronger balance sheet.
